Chai tea is a blend of black tea, spices such as cinnamon, cardamom, and ginger, and milk. It is often sweetened and can be served hot or cold.
The combination of the tea and spices creates a warm and comforting flavor that is perfect for a chilly day or a relaxing afternoon.
